Importance of Home Addition Permits
When embarking on a home addition project, safeguarding the required licenses is essential. Without proper authorizations, you run the risk of facing fines, needing to remodel work, or even stopping your project completely. Permits aren't simply a rule; they ensure that your home addition meets security requirements and zoning policies.
By obtaining authorizations, you show that your job abide by building codes, fire guidelines, and various other essential needs.
Permits also shield you as a homeowner. In the event of an accident or damage related to the construction, having permits in place can assist shield you from responsibility. Furthermore, when it comes time to sell your home, potential buyers might request documents to guarantee that all improvements were done legally and up to code.

Compliance With Zoning Laws
Comprehending and adhering to zoning laws is critical when planning a home enhancement. Zoning legislations regulate exactly how residential properties can be used and established within a certain area. Prior to beginning your home addition task, it's essential to talk to your regional zoning division to recognize the laws that relate to your building.
